From e056664cfb8e8ac79e86b610725169f6abcf2380 Mon Sep 17 00:00:00 2001 From: Michael Chirico Date: Tue, 5 Dec 2023 14:58:08 +0800 Subject: [PATCH] Need fixed=TRUE --- .dev/lint_metadata_test.R | 16 ++++++++++------ 1 file changed, 10 insertions(+), 6 deletions(-) diff --git a/.dev/lint_metadata_test.R b/.dev/lint_metadata_test.R index 1b8f2ca43..19c18ce87 100644 --- a/.dev/lint_metadata_test.R +++ b/.dev/lint_metadata_test.R @@ -5,13 +5,17 @@ library(testthat) xml_nodes_to_lints_file <- "R/xml_nodes_to_lints.R" -xml_nodes_to_lints_file |> - readLines() |> +original <- readLines(xml_nodes_to_lints_file) +writeLines( sub( - pattern = "line_number = as.integer(line1)", - replacement = "line_number = as.integer(2^31 - 1)" - ) |> - writeLines(xml_nodes_to_lints_file) + "line_number = as.integer(line1)", + "line_number = as.integer(2^31 - 1)", + fixed = TRUE + ), + xml_nodes_to_lints_file +) +# Not useful in CI but good when running locally. +withr::defer(writeLines(original, xml_nodes_to_lints_file)) pkgload::load_all()